About the Role:
Keeley Construction is actively seeking dependable, driven individuals with general construction experience to join our fast-growing team. This is a hands-on role that supports a range of field operations—including concrete, carpentry, asphalt and paving. We value candidates with strong overall construction backgrounds who are eager to contribute, learn, and grow within a collaborative field crew environment.
Key Responsibilities:
Perform general job site maintenance and repair work (e.g., fence repair, debris removal, site prep).
Operate hand and power tools, including blowers, squeegees, crack filling equipment, power washers, and spray systems.
Set up and dismantle traffic control devices (cones, signage, barricades) to maintain job site safety.
Execute physical labor tasks such as raking, sweeping, shoveling, and material handling.
Assist equipment operators by spotting and aligning materials for safe and efficient operation.
Maintain clean, organized work areas and assist with basic equipment maintenance.
Communicate effectively with crew members, foremen, and other site personnel.
Adhere to all Keeley Construction and OSHA safety protocols at all times.
Record daily job activities and report project updates as needed.
Demonstrate punctuality, dependability, and readiness to work every day.
Take on additional responsibilities as assigned by leadership.
Required Qualifications:
Minimum of 1 year general construction experience (e.g., site work, fencing, carpentry, demolition, or related fields).
Sealcoat/asphalt experience is a plus but not required.
High school diploma or GED is preferred.
Must be 21 years or older with a valid driver's license and a clean driving record (no DUIs within the past 3 years); CDL is a plus.
Physically fit and able to work in demanding outdoor environments.
Strong attention to detail, adaptability, and a willingness to learn new skills.
Consistent attendance and a strong work ethic are essential.
Must pass a pre-employment assessment and drug screening .
